Basement stabilization is a crucial home improvement project for many homeowners in Asheville, NC. The cost of this service can vary widely based on several factors. Understanding these factors can help you better estimate the potential expenses involved in stabilizing your basement.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Extent of Damage: The severity of the foundation issues will significantly impact the overall cost.
- Type of Stabilization Required: Different methods such as underpinning, wall anchors, or slab jacking come with varying price tags.
- Size of Basement: Larger basements will naturally require more materials and labor, increasing the cost.
- Soil Conditions: The type of soil around your home can affect the complexity and cost of the project.
- Accessibility: Hard-to-reach areas may require specialized equipment, adding to the cost.
- Local Labor Rates: Labor costs can vary, and Asheville, NC, may have different rates compared to other regions.
-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may necessitate permits and inspections, which can add to the overall expense.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ost (Asheville, NC) |
---|---|
Foundation Inspection | $300 - $500 |
Minor Crack Repairs | $500 - $1,000 |
Wall Anchors Installation | $3,000 - $7,500 |
Underpinning | $1,000 - $3,000 per pier |
Slab Jacking | $500 - $1,300 per section |
Waterproofing | $2,000 - $6,000 |
Full Basement Stabilization | $5,000 - $15,000 |
